Figures for 1989, the Stasi's last full year, from the Stasi Records Archive and standard histories. Informer estimates vary between studies; "about 1 in 90" uses roughly 189,000 unofficial informers against a population of about 16.4 million. The often-quoted "one in 6.5 people" counts every part-time contact and is disputed by historians, so it is not used here.
